HAIRWORLD - THE PURSUIT OF EXCELLENCE

Wednesday, July 25, 2007
8:00-9:00 p.m. ET, PBS

Acclaimed Documentary Filmmaker Mark Lewis ("The Natural History of the Chicken") follows the United States Hair Styling Team in His Latest Special for PBS.

HAIRWORLD: THE PURSUIT OF EXCELLENCE follows the National Cosmetology Association’s (NCA) Team USA as its members clip, comb and spray their way to the 31st HairWorld Championships in Moscow, Russia, where 800 stylists from 50 countries compete for gold, silver and bronze medals in timed tests of styling skill. The program airs Wednesday, July 25, 2007, 8:00-9:00 p.m. ET on PBS (check local listings as air times vary by market).

Often described as the "Olympics" of hairdressing, HAIRWORLD captures the vivid sculptures of hair, the daring couture, the stunning models and the cheers of the crowd as high fashion meets fierce international rivalry in this battle of the bouffant. "Just imagine the sporting Olympics with all the different countries represented and all of the noise and all of the pride and the cheering," explains NCA competitor Dale Dees. "That is how our Olympic event is. It's the same energy. It's the same power. It's the same camaraderie. Even though you can't understand each other, you know that hair looks pretty darn amazing, and so you understand that."

Although the competition in the main categories can last less than an hour, preparation takes many months. HAIRWORLD follows the three NCA team trainers, Ron Hawkins in North Carolina, Andrea Turrisi in Connecticut and Michael Della Penna in Florida, as they embark on rigorous training with their teams. Each competitor works with his or her trainer to create the perfect look, balancing originality and complexity with the constraints of the competition. For months before competition, they practice their prescribed hairstyles time after time, day after day. "There's no days off," insists competitor Danny DiLeo. "There's no 'let's go to the movies'; there's none of that. It's absolutely train, train, and train, and then … train."

Viewers meet some of the members of the NCA’s Team USA as they prepare for what may be the most important day of their careers. Dale Dees from Orlando, Florida, discovered his passion for hairstyling while singing and dancing in a traveling theatre group. Dees left the theatre and joined cosmetology school, but it wasn't long before he found himself in the spotlight again - this time on the competition floor. "It consumes your life to be a stylist; it really does. It has to be something that is in your blood. It has to be something you eat, drink, sleep and breathe." Although each character is diverse in background, each expresses the same love, passion and fierce ambition for competitive hairstyling. "The focus is the creativity and having the love," says team trainer Ron Hawkins. "I think that plays an important factor, is having the love of being able to do it and being involved in it. You've got to love it."

As HairWorld draws closer, Team USA fights to overcome dramatic setbacks - a devastating flood and a shocking wrist injury - until their creative visions finally unfold strand by strand on the competition floor.

THE PURSUIT OF EXCELLENCE, a series of four one-hour films, celebrates the ambition, determination and passion of those who pursue distinction in slightly unconventional fields. Each film showcases the training and preparation required to be competitive and reveals the surprising, and sometimes heartbreaking, results of that dedication. The featured characters, diverse in background, are endearing and sympathetic, people consumed by their individual quests for excellence. Other programs in the series include SYNCHRONIZED SWIMMING (7/11), FERRETS (7/18) and LORDS OF THE GOURD (fall 2007).

Filmmaker Mark Lewis' THE NATURAL HISTORY OF THE CHICKEN was screened in competition at Sundance and was named by The New York Times one of the top 10 television programs for 2001. Lewis won two Emmys for the film: Outstanding Science Program and Outstanding Direction.


OMC HairWorld 2008 Rules Are Now Available!

Known as the "Olympics of Hair," the 2008 OMC HairWorld Championships of Beauty will draw more than 1,200 competitors and teams representing 50 plus countries. The OMC HairWorld Championship Arena will be the setting of the thrilling three-day competitions, which will include contests in hair, nails and makeup, many of which offer separate awards for "seniors" (licensed professionals) and juniors (professionals and students under the age of 25).
